This is a project book that guides you through the process of building a traditional Access desktop database that uses one Access database as the front-end (queries, reports, and forms) and another Access database to contain the tables and data. By separating the data from the rest of the database, the Access database can be easily shared by multiple users over a network. When you build a database correctly at the outset, later this database can be migrated to another system with fewer issues and fewer objects that need to be redone. FEATURES * Understand the concepts of normalization * Build tables and links to other data sources and understand table relationships * Connect and work with data stored in other formats (Text, Word, Excel, Outlook, and PowerPoint) * Retrieve data with DAO, ADO, and DLookup statements * Learn how to process text files for import and export * Create expressions, queries, and SQL statements * Build bound and unbound forms and reports and write code to preview and print * Incorporate macros in your database * Work with attachments and image files * Learn how to display and query your Access data in the Internet browser * Secure your database for multi-user access * Compact your database to prevent corruption resulting in data loss

Why simple technological solutions to complex social issues continue to appeal to politicians and professionals who should (and often do) know better. Why do we keep trying to solve poverty with technology? What makes us feel that we need to learn to code--or else? In The Promise of Access, Daniel Greene argues that the problem of poverty became a problem of technology in order to manage the contradictions of a changing economy. Greene shows how the digital divide emerged as a policy problem and why simple technological solutions to complex social issues continue to appeal to politicians and professionals who should (and often do) know better.

The definitive Cisco SD-Access resource, from the architects who train Cisco's own engineers and partners This comprehensive book guides you through all aspects of planning, implementing, and operating Cisco Software-Defined Access (SD-Access). Through practical use cases, you'll learn how to use intent-based networking, Cisco ISE, and Cisco DNA Center to improve any campus network's security and simplify its management. Drawing on their unsurpassed experience architecting solutions and training technical professionals inside and outside Cisco, the authors explain when and where to leverage Cisco SD-Access instead of a traditional legacy design. They illuminate the fundamental building blocks of a modern campus fabric architecture, show how to design a software-defined campus that delivers the most value in your environment, and introduce best practices for administration, support, and troubleshooting. Case studies show how to use Cisco SD-Access to address secure segmentation, plug and play, software image management (SWIM), host mobility, and more. The authors also present full chapters on advanced Cisco SD-Access and Cisco DNA Center topics, plus detailed coverage of Cisco DNA monitoring and analytics. * Learn how Cisco SD-Access addresses key drivers for network change, including automation and security * Explore how Cisco DNA Center improves network planning, deployment, evolution, and agility * Master Cisco SD-Access essentials: design, components, best practices, and fabric construction * Integrate Cisco DNA Center and Cisco ISE, and smoothly onboard diverse endpoints * Efficiently operate Cisco SD-Access and troubleshoot common fabric problems, step by step * Master advanced topics, including multicast flows, Layer 2 flooding, and the integration of IoT devices * Extend campus network policies to WANs and data center networks * Choose the right deployment options for Cisco DNA Center in your environment * Master Cisco DNA Assurance analytics and tests for optimizing the health of clients, network devices, and applications

Prepare for Microsoft Exam SC-300 and demonstrate your real-world ability to design, implement, and operate identity and access management systems with Microsoft Azure Active Directory (AD). Designed for professionals involved in secure authentication, access, or identity management, this Exam Ref focuses on the critical thinking and decision-making acumen needed for success at the Microsoft Certified: Identity and Access Administrator Associate level. Focus on the expertise measured by these objectives: Implement identities in Azure AD Implement authentication and access management Implement access management for applications Plan and implement identity governance in Azure AD This Microsoft Exam Ref: Organizes its coverage by exam objectives Features strategic, what-if scenarios to challenge you Assumes that you are an administrator, security engineer, or other IT professional who provides, or plans to provide, secure identity and access services for an enterprise About the Exam Exam SC-300 focuses on the knowledge needed to configure and manage Azure AD tenants; create, configure, and manage Azure AD identities; implement and manage external identities and hybrid identity; plan, implement, and manage Azure Multifactor Authentication (MFA), self-service password reset, Azure AD user authentication, and Azure AD conditional access; manage Azure AD Identity Protection; implement access management for Azure resources; manage and monitor app access with Microsoft Defender for Cloud Apps; plan, implement, and monitor enterprise app integration; enable app registration; plan and implement entitlement management and privileged access; plan, implement, and manage access reviews; and monitor Azure AD. About Microsoft Certification Passing this exam fulfills your requirements for the Microsoft Certified: Identity and Access Administrator Associate certification, demonstrating your abilities to design, implement, and operate identity and access management systems with Azure AD; configure and manage identity authentication and authorization for users, devices, resources, and applications; provide seamless experiences and self-service; verify identities for Zero Trust; automate Azure AD management; troubleshoot and monitor identity and access environments; and collaborate to drive strategic identity projects, modernize identity solutions, and implement hybrid identity and/or identity governance.
